#cd1888 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d1888 is composed of 80.4% red, 9.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.3% magenta, 33.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 44.9%. #cd1888 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#9b0011.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#cd1888 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d1888 has RGB values of R:205, G:24,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.34,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13441160.

Shades and Tints of #cd1888
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0108 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d1888
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757073 is the less saturated color, while #df068c is the most saturated one.
